Auto-provision TLS certificates during reconciliation
Replace the passive "log warning about missing certs" approach with active auto-provisioning: - When Cloudflare token and operator email are configured, automatically provision missing certs via certbot DNS-01 during reconciliation - When credentials aren't available, log actionable guidance (no longer references a non-existent "Certificates page") - Track TLS health in reconciler Health struct (ok/degraded with missing cert list) - Broadcast tls:recovered SSE event when all certs become available - Add CertManager interface and GetCloudflareToken callback to reconciler The convergence loop (5 min) continuously retries failed provisions, so transient DNS-01 failures self-heal on the next tick.
